Critical Services Given by Asphalt Contractors

A selection of important services are regularly provided by asphalt contractors, serving both home and commercial needs. These solutions frequently feature asphalt paving, where contractors install fresh asphalt for driveways, parking lots, and roads. Additionally, they deliver asphalt repair services, resolving cracks and potholes to boost durability and safety. Sealcoating is another essential offering, protecting asphalt surfaces from weather damage and increasing their lifespan.

Furthermore, service providers may offer grading and drainage solutions, guaranteeing proper water flow and avoiding upcoming damage. Pavement marking is also offered, marking parking spaces and traffic lines for improved organization and safety. Some asphalt contractors provide upkeep programs, which include regular inspections and upkeep to extend the lifespan of asphalt surfaces. By understanding these essential services, property managers can choose wisely when choosing an asphalt contractor for their paving projects.

Assessing Offers and Pricing Structures

Evaluating bids and pricing structures from different asphalt contractors is essential for choosing wisely. When reviewing estimates, it is crucial to examine not only the total cost but also the detailed list of materials, labor, and any extra charges. A cheaper estimate may look attractive, but it could indicate compromises in quality or service.

Contractors commonly present different cost structures; some may charge by square footage, while others might propose flat rates. Understanding these variations can help clients assess the true worth of each proposal.

Moreover, clients should learn about warranties and maintenance options, which can modify extended expenses. It is best practice to request explicit written quotations to guarantee transparency and assist accurate comparisons. By deliberately examining these points, consumers can appoint a builder that coordinates with their budget and quality expectations, ultimately leading to a prosperous paving endeavor.

Red Flags to Watch for When Employing an Asphalt Contractor

What markers should an individual spot when hiring an asphalt contractor? Several danger signs can warn of trouble looming. First, missing sufficient licensing and coverage is a crucial danger sign; quality contractors should happily give this documentation. Furthermore, if a contractor quotes an remarkably low estimate, it may reveal substandard materials or workmanship.

An extra worry surfaces when a contractor is unwilling to offer testimonials or a portfolio of past work, as this may indicate a lack of experience or unsatisfactory previous projects. In addition, vague or ambiguous contracts can cause confusion and unexpected costs in the future. Ultimately, high-pressure sales tactics should raise suspicions; reliable contractors will allow clients opportunity to make conclusions. By remaining alert and identifying these warning signs, property owners can better protect themselves from potential pitfalls in their paving projects.

What Style of Asphalt Options Would You Recommend?

The contractor suggested implementing high-quality hot mix asphalt for performance and durability. Furthermore, they advised considering porous asphalt for environmental benefits, or cold mix asphalt for temporary repairs, based on the particular project requirements and conditions.
